Where does “плавно” come from?

плавно (Bulgarian) comes from Bulgarian пла́вен, from Bulgarian пла́вам, from Proto-Slavic plavati, from Proto-Slavic plàviti, from Proto-Slavic -vati.

плавно (Bulgarian): smoothly; steadily
